? export_ui_revert_delete.patch Index: plugins/export_ui/ctools_export_ui.class.php =================================================================== RCS file: /cvs/drupal-contrib/contributions/modules/ctools/plugins/export_ui/Attic/ctools_export_ui.class.php,v retrieving revision 1.1.2.15 diff -u -p -r1.1.2.15 ctools_export_ui.class.php --- plugins/export_ui/ctools_export_ui.class.php 2 Aug 2010 19:29:43 -0000 1.1.2.15 +++ plugins/export_ui/ctools_export_ui.class.php 5 Aug 2010 17:22:52 -0000 @@ -1310,8 +1310,9 @@ function ctools_export_ui_edit_item_form */ function ctools_export_ui_edit_item_form_delete(&$form, &$form_state) { $export_key = $form_state['plugin']['export']['key']; + $path = $form_state['item']->export_type & EXPORT_IN_CODE ? 'revert' : 'delete'; - drupal_goto(ctools_export_ui_plugin_menu_path($form_state['plugin'], 'delete', $form_state['item']->{$export_key}), array('cancel_path' => $_GET['q'])); + drupal_goto(ctools_export_ui_plugin_menu_path($form_state['plugin'], $path, $form_state['item']->{$export_key}), array('cancel_path' => $_GET['q'])); } /**